tarhamehiläinen

Finnish

noun
Definitions
  • honey bee, especially the , Apis mellifera, which is the only honey bee species that survives the Finnish winter

Etymology

Compound from Finnish tarha (garden, yard, park) + Finnish mehiläinen (bee, of bees).
